#a02630 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a02630 is composed of 62.7% red, 14.9%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 70%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 355.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 38.8%. #a02630 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c60 with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a02630 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a02630 has RGB values of R:160, G:38,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.7,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10495536.

Shades and Tints of #a02630
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f2 is the lightest one.
